Main article: 2019 Miami Open
Elise Mertens and Aryna Sabalenka defeated Samantha Stosur and Zhang Shuai in the final, 7–6(7–5), 6–2 to win the women's doubles tennis title at the 2019 Miami Open. With the win, they completed the Sunshine Double, having won Indian Wells two weeks prior.
Ashleigh Barty and CoCo Vandeweghe were the reigning champions,[1] but Vandeweghe did not participate due to injury. Barty partnered Victoria Azarenka, but lost in the semifinals to Mertens and Sabalenka.
